Transaction 6e5e94208a09f57ddc8280c7d264430661d4b818af78f7f95defa504dfbb56f6
1 Input
1 Output
-
6e5e94208a09f57ddc8280c7d264430661d4b818af78f7f95defa504dfbb56f6:0
- value
- 80506293
- script pubkey
- OP_0 OP_PUSHBYTES_20 02e646e0b7e4af61d1d9fb52763a170e5de80beb
- address
- bc1qqtnydc9hujhkr5weldf8vwshpew7szltchjphr